Description A yellow tint to the skin or eyes caused by an excess of bilirubin, a substance released when red blood cells break down and the liver fails to process it.

When to seek immediate medical care See a healthcare professional right away for: Any yellow tint to skin or eyes in infant, child or adult; jaundice must always be evaluated by a healthcare professional.
